I recently got an awesome deal on a 6.0 with a 4L80E with 68k on it for $1150 but my Yukon is 4wd. I will be tearing everything down, engine and trans, and from what I understand if I want to make the 4L80E work in my truck, I will need to change out the output shaft on the trans, I believe the input shaft in the transfer case, along with a 4L80E to Transfer case adapter, and New drive shafts for the front and back. If I left anything out, or I'm incorrect on anything please let me know. Also I really have no idea where I should start looking for this stuff I need. Sounds about right. You also need to section and lengthen your trans crossmember, lengthened trans fluid lines, new dipstick tube, new flexplate and spacer for the engine, new harness for the second VSS, and either change the wiring on the big round connector or buy the adapter.
